Sajeeb Wazed Joy. FILE PHOTOBangladesh Awami League will clinch victory in the upcoming national polls by winning more constituencies than the 2008 election,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ina's son Sajeeb Wazed Joy wrote in his social media post around 1am on Thursday (Dec 13).
Quoting research report findings, he wrote on his Facebook post, “Awami League will win 168 to 222 seats in the upcoming election. The party will win through a better margin than the 2008 election.”
Joy, who has been serving the PM as her ICT affairs adviser, also wrote on his Facebook post, “We conducted the biggest polls opinion survey from August to October this year by a neutral research organization, Research and Development Centre (RDC), which also surveyed the last mayoral election.
You may remember that I shared the survey report on my Facebook page and the election results were pretty much matched with the survey findings."
